Leadership Review Briefing — Pilot Churn

The Harrowgate pilot of the Lenfield subscription service lost 14% of enrolled customers in its first quarter, above the 9% forecast. Exit surveys point to onboarding friction rather than pricing. Corrective steps — simplified setup and a dedicated support line — begin next month. The incoming director should review the churn dashboard weekly and note the plan summarised below.

board note of kageg-bahof: The renewal with Holwynax Holdings closes at $2 million a year, 5 percent below the last contract. Project Ulaath slips by two quarters because of the supplier delay.

## Bulk Edits in the Grelling Admin Table

A note for whoever inherits this: bulk edits in the admin grid are deliberately throttled. Early on, someone mass-updated forty thousand rows and pinned the Dunmore replica for an afternoon, so now edits go through a chunked queue with per-operator quotas and a hard row ceiling per request. Oversized jobs get split automatically. Before you loosen anything, know that the current limits are these.

tuning table, kajog-bawip:
TIERS = {
    "kelius": 256,
    "lammir": 543,
}

# Break-Glass: Catalog Cache Invalidation

Scope: the Pinrow product catalog at Veldstone Retail. If stale prices persist after a purge and the Hollowmere invalidation queue is wedged, use break-glass to flush the edge tier directly. Contractors: get verbal sign-off from the catalog lead first. Steps: open the Hollowmere admin shell, select emergency-flush, confirm the tenant, and run it once — repeated flushes thrash the origin. Access is logged and expires after 20 minutes. Unseal the admin shell with the passphrase below.

recovery phrase for kahop-tajog: istix-casvan

Handover note for new team members: Ovenline's order-cutoff rule closes next-day bakery orders at 14:00 shop-local time, enforced by the scheduler, not the storefront. Do not adjust the cutoff in config without updating both services together. The cutoff override console is sealed; the recovery passphrase to open it is below.

recovery phrase for tawig-kahag: olimir-praath